Ubisoft’s shiny new remake, Assassin’s Creed Black Flag Resynced, is taking on serious water on Steam. Despite charging full price for the base game, the publisher dropped a staggering $85 worth of microtransactions on launch day. As negative reviews flood in, Ubisoft attempted to calm the waters by arguing that the extra purchases are entirely optional and don’t gatekeep the core game. Players, however, aren’t buying the excuse—metaphorically or literally—and are blasting the publisher for aggressively monetizing a beloved classic.
